- #include <common.h>
- #include <asm/io.h>
- DECLARE_GLOBAL_DATA_PTR;
- #define LINUX_ARM_ZIMAGE_MAGIC 0x016f2818
- struct arm_z_header {
- uint32_t code[9];
- uint32_t zi_magic;
- uint32_t zi_start;
- uint32_t zi_end;
- } __attribute__ ((__packed__));
- int bootz_setup(ulong image, ulong *start, ulong *end)
- {
- uint8_t *zimage = map_sysmem(image, 0);
- struct arm_z_header *arm_hdr = (struct arm_z_header *)zimage;
- int ret = 0;
- if (memcmp(zimage + 0x202, "HdrS", 4) == 0) {
- uint8_t setup_sects = *(zimage + 0x1f1);
- uint32_t syssize =
- le32_to_cpu(*(uint32_t *)(zimage + 0x1f4));
- *start = 0;
- *end = (setup_sects + 1) * 512 + syssize * 16;
- printf("setting up X86 zImage [ %ld - %ld ]\n",
- *start, *end);
- } else if (le32_to_cpu(arm_hdr->zi_magic) == LINUX_ARM_ZIMAGE_MAGIC) {
- *start = le32_to_cpu(arm_hdr->zi_start);
- *end = le32_to_cpu(arm_hdr->zi_end);
- printf("setting up ARM zImage [ %ld - %ld ]\n",
- *start, *end);
- } else {
- printf("Unrecognized zImage\n");
- ret = 1;
- }
- unmap_sysmem((void *)image);
- return ret;
- }
